Child Support Guidelines: Elements of an Order for support of a child

Form of payments

11. Where the child support guidelines apply to orders made under the Divorce Act (Canada), section 34 of the Act applies. O. Reg. 391/97, s. 11; O. Reg. 25/10, s. 3.

Security

12. The court may require in the order for the support of a child that the amount payable under the order be paid or secured, or paid and secured, in the manner specified in the order. O. Reg. 391/97, s. 12.

Information to be specified in order

13. An order for the support of a child must include,

(a) the name and birth date of each child to whom the order relates;

(b) the income of any parent or spouse whose income is used to determine the amount of the order;

(c) the amount determined under clause 3 (1) (a) for the number of children to whom the order relates;

(d) the amount determined under clause 3 (2) (b) for a child the age of majority or over;

(e) the particulars of any expense described in subsection 7 (1), the child to whom the expense relates and the amount of the expense or, where that amount cannot be determined, the proportion to be paid in relation to the expense;

(f) the date on which the lump sum or first payment is payable and the day of the month or other time period on which all subsequent payments are to be made; and

(g) reference to the obligation under subsection 24.1 (1) to provide updated income information no later than 30 days after the anniversary of the date on which the order is made in every year in which the child is a child within the meaning of this Regulation, unless the parties agree that the obligation shall not apply, as provided for in that subsection. O. Reg. 391/97, s. 13; O. Reg. 25/10, s. 4.
